Drain tile installation services involve the placement of specialized drainage systems designed to manage excess water around a property’s foundation, basement, or landscape. These systems typically consist of perforated pipes installed underground, often surrounded by gravel or other porous materials, to direct water away from critical areas. Proper installation ensures that water is efficiently channeled to designated drainage points, helping to maintain the stability and dryness of the property’s structure. Experienced service providers evaluate the specific drainage needs of each property and tailor the installation process accordingly to optimize water flow and prevent future issues.
This service addresses common problems related to excess water accumulation, such as basement flooding, foundation cracks, and soil erosion. Poor drainage can lead to persistent dampness, mold growth, and structural damage over time. Drain tile systems are especially effective in areas prone to heavy rainfall or with high water tables, as they help reduce hydrostatic pressure against foundations. By installing a reliable drainage network, property owners can mitigate the risk of water-related damage and improve overall property stability and longevity.

Material Costs - The cost of materials for drain tile installation typically ranges from $10 to $25 per linear foot, depending on the type of piping and additional components needed. For a standard residential project, material expenses can total between $500 and $1,500. Variations depend on pipe quality and project scope.
Labor Expenses - Labor costs for installing drain tiles generally fall between $50 and $100 per hour. A typical installation may take several hours to a full day, resulting in total labor charges from $300 to $1,000. Complexity and site conditions influence overall labor expenses.
Project Size - The overall cost varies with the size of the area requiring drainage, with small projects starting around $1,000 and larger, more complex installations exceeding $3,000. Larger properties or extensive drainage systems tend to increase the total cost significantly. Local pros can provide tailored estimates based on project scope.
Additional Costs - Extra expenses may include site preparation, trenching, and backfilling, which can add $200 to $600 to the total cost. Permits or inspections might also be necessary, depending on local regulations. Contact local service providers for detailed cost assessments.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
